The process of “creating” content, in my case a book, is usually something complex and differs from person to person. Here I’ll describe how it works for me, and how I can effectively cooperate with my brother to lay out the story of The S.T.E.A.L. Saga.
First of all, usually my brother has the original idea. Usually it’s vague and not quite definite, but enough to start a discussion. Generally he explains the basic idea to me while I take notes, and occasionally we adjust things on the fly depending on our taste. Once the skeleton of the story (from start to finish) is laid out, I begin writing.
This is not where it ends, however. As people who read the snapshots have surely noticed, things change either because I find better ideas along the way, or because I’m not satisfied in how they play out. So there is more discussion and adjustments, and occasionally rewrites (chapter 4 of Lost Innocence and the last three chapters of People of the Darkness are examples of that). Also I or my brother may want a particular character to act in a certain way so this brings even more adjustments.
The result is the books you read. I hope you like them.
